How to Get a Business Credit Card for an LLC?

Starting a business involves many steps, and one crucial aspect is managing finances effectively. For a Limited Liability Company (LLC), obtaining a business credit card can be a significant step towards building business credit, tracking expenses, and separating personal and business finances. Understanding the process and requirements for getting a business credit card for an LLC can help streamline this important task.

How to get a business credit card for an LLC? To get a business credit card for an LLC, you need to follow several steps. Firstly, ensure that your LLC is officially registered and has an Employer Identification Number (EIN) from the IRS. This number is essential for applying for a business credit card. Secondly, gather all necessary documentation, including your LLC’s formation documents, financial statements, and personal credit information. Thirdly, research and compare different business credit card options to find one that suits your business needs. Finally, complete the application process by providing all required information and documentation to the chosen credit card issuer.

Step-by-Step Process

Registering your LLC and obtaining an EIN is the first step in the process. The EIN acts like a Social Security number for your business and is required for tax purposes and opening business accounts. You can apply for an EIN online through the IRS website, and it usually takes just a few minutes to receive your number.

Next, gather all the necessary documentation. This typically includes your LLC’s formation documents, such as Articles of Organization, and financial statements. Lenders will also want to see your personal credit information, as your credit score can impact the approval process and the terms of the credit card.

Choosing the Right Card

When researching business credit cards, consider factors such as interest rates, rewards programs, and fees. Some cards offer cash back or travel rewards, which can be beneficial depending on your business expenses. Compare different options to find a card that aligns with your business’s financial habits and needs.

Once you’ve selected a credit card, complete the application process. This will involve providing detailed information about your LLC, including its EIN, revenue, and expenses. Some issuers may also require a personal guarantee, which means you’ll be personally responsible for the debt if the business cannot pay.

After submitting your application, the issuer will review your information and make a decision. If approved, you’ll receive your business credit card, which you can start using for business expenses. Regular use and timely payments can help build your business credit, making it easier to obtain financing in the future.

Managing a business credit card responsibly involves keeping track of expenses, paying off the balance in full each month, and monitoring your credit report regularly. This can help maintain a good credit score and ensure the financial health of your LLC.
